How to put the contours in a image numbers? (OCR)


I've been studying CV for a few months now but I ran into a problem on my second project, I needed to remove the noise from a sequence of numbers, in order to apply ocr. I managed to clean it up, but the numbers lost some internal pixels.

See the initial and current final image.

Initial

Final

Code used:

blur = cv2.GaussianBlur(img, (15, 15), 2)
hsv = cv2.cvtColor(blur, cv2.COLOR_BGR2HSV)
lower_gray = np.array([1, 1, 1])
upper_gray = np.array([102, 102, 102])
mask = cv2.inRange(hsv, lower_gray, upper_gray)

kernel = cv2.getStructuringElement(cv2.MORPH_ELLIPSE, (3, 3))
opened_mask = cv2.morphologyEx(mask, cv2.MORPH_OPEN, kernel)
masked_img = cv2.bitwise_and(img, img, mask=opened_mask)
coloured = masked_img.copy()
coloured[mask == 0] = (255, 255, 255)

gray = cv2.cvtColor(coloured, cv2.COLOR_BGR2GRAY)

des = cv2.bitwise_not(gray)

contour, hier = cv2.findContours(des, cv2.RETR_CCOMP, cv2.CHAIN_APPROX_SIMPLE)

for cnt in contour:
    cv2.drawContours(des, [cnt], 0, 255, -1)

#des is the final image

Is there a better way to clean the background for OCR, or maybe close the lost pixels in the characters?
